OnTopLending information

  • Loan limit: $100 - $5000.
  • Interest rate: up to 18.25%/year.
  • Loan term: up to 18 months.

Transparency in Loan Terms: A Clear Understanding of Costs

Prior to accepting any loan offer, a meticulous review of the terms and conditions is essential. Legitimate lenders will disclose all loan details upfront, including:

  • Interest Rates: The interest rate offered by OnTopLending significantly impacts your total loan repayment amount. Carefully scrutinize this rate to ensure it aligns with your budget and financial goals.
  • Fees: Be mindful of any associated fees, such as origination fees, late fees, or prepayment penalties, that OnTopLending may charge. Factor these fees into your decision-making process, as they can add to the overall cost of the loan.
  • Repayment Terms: A complete understanding of the repayment terms offered by OnTopLending is crucial. This includes the loan term (duration) and the monthly payment amount. Knowing the repayment schedule allows you to determine if the loan comfortably fits within your existing budget.

Identifying Warning Signs: Avoiding Predatory Lending Practices

Certain red flags may indicate that OnTopLending is not a legitimate lender. Be wary of the following:

  • Guaranteed Loan Approval: Legitimate lenders consider various factors, including creditworthiness, income, and debt-to-income ratio, before approving a loan. A guarantee of approval from OnTopLending, particularly for borrowers with poor credit, can be a red flag, as it often comes with exorbitant interest rates and unfavorable terms.
  • Upfront Fees: Legitimate lenders typically do not require upfront fees for applications or loan processing. Be cautious if OnTopLending requests upfront fees before loan approval.
  • High-Pressure Sales Tactics: If OnTopLending resorts to aggressive sales tactics, pressuring you to accept a loan without sufficient time for review, it's a significant warning sign. A reputable lender will encourage you to take your time, review the loan agreement carefully, and ask questions before committing.

Exploring Alternatives and Promoting Financial Literacy

Before considering a loan from OnTopLending, explore alternative solutions to address your financial needs:

  • Utilize Savings: Can you tap into your existing savings to cover the expense? This is the most cost-effective option, as you won't incur interest charges.
  • Consolidate Debt: Could consolidating existing high-interest debt into a lower-interest loan with a reputable lender be a more sustainable solution?
  • Create a Budget: Develop a budget to identify areas where you can cut unnecessary expenses and start saving up for the desired expense over time. This can help you avoid relying on high-cost loans in the future.

Financial literacy is paramount when considering any loan. Clearly define the purpose of the loan and the amount you require. Most importantly, only borrow what you can comfortably repay within your existing budget.
